var stringstr = ""; var stringstr1 = ""; var form_main; function callfunction(action,form) { if(action=="tstate") var id = document.searchForm.sel_state.value ; else if(action=="tcity") var id = document.searchForm.sel_city.value ; else if(action=="tcat") var id = form.category.value ; form_main=form; var url="../include/details.php?id="+id+"&act="+action ; //for non-IE browsers if(window.XMLHttpRequest) { req=new XMLHttpRequest(); } else //IF IE browsers if(window.ActiveXObject) { req=new ActiveXObject("Microsoft.XMLHTTP"); } req.open("POST",url,true); req.onreadystatechange=parseResults ; req.send(null); } function parseResults() { //var combo1 = new Array() ; var selectedarray = new Array() ; var combo1 = new Array() ; if(req.readyState==4) { if(req.status==200) { SResponse=req.responseText; var details = SResponse.split("####") ; if(details[0]=="tstate") { var pack = details[1].split("!!!!"); for(var y=0 ; y0;m--) cacheobj.options[m]=null selectedarray=eval(combo1) for (var i=0;i0;m--) cacheobj.options[m]=null selectedarray=eval(combo1) for (var i=0;i 0; i--) { sub_select.options[i] = null; } for (var i = make_select.options.length - 1; i > 0; i--) { make_select.options[i] = null; } for (var i = form_main.sel_model.options.length - 1; i > 0 ; i--) { //even clear the model data, because it could be wrong form_main.sel_model.options[i] = null; } // parse info var sub_and_make = details[1].split("||||"); var sub = sub_and_make[0]; var make = sub_and_make[1]; // finish parse, and insert new options pack = sub.split("!!!!"); for (var i = 0; i < sub.length; i++) { if (pack[i]) { var id_and_part = pack[i].split("@@@@"); sub_select.options[i + 1] = new Option (id_and_part[1], id_and_part[0]); } } pack = make.split("!!!!"); for (var i = 0; i < make.length; i++) { if (pack[i]) { var id_and_make = pack[i].split("@@@@"); make_select.options[i + 1] = new Option (id_and_make[1], id_and_make[0]); } } } } else { alert ( "Server is busy please try later!" ); } } } function callfunction_search(action,form) { if (form == null) form = document.signupform; if(action=="tstate") var id = form.sel_state.value ; else if(action=="tcity") var id = form.sel_city.value ; else if(action=="tmake") var id = form.make.value ; form_main=form; var url="../include/details.php?id="+id+"&act="+action ; //for non-IE browsers if(window.XMLHttpRequest) { req=new XMLHttpRequest(); } else //IF IE browsers if(window.ActiveXObject) { req=new ActiveXObject("Microsoft.XMLHTTP"); } req.open("POST",url,true); req.onreadystatechange=parseResults1 ; req.send(null); } function parseResults1() { //var combo1 = new Array() ; var selectedarray = new Array() ; var combo1 = new Array() ; if(req.readyState==4) { if(req.status==200) { SResponse=req.responseText; var details = SResponse.split("####") ; //alert(details[0]); //alert(details[1]); if(details[0]=="tstate") { var pack = details[1].split("!!!!"); //var packid = details[2].split("!!!!") ; for(var y=0 ; y0;m--) cacheobj.options[m]=null selectedarray=eval(combo1) for (var i=0;i0;m--) cacheobj.options[m]=null selectedarray=eval(combo1) for (var i=0;i 0 ; m--) { cacheobj.options[m]=null } var pack = details[1].split("!!!!"); for (var i = 0; i < pack.length; i++) { if (pack[i]) { small_pack = pack[i].split("@@@@"); id = small_pack[0]; model = small_pack[1]; cacheobj.options[i + 1] = new Option (model, id); } } } } else { alert ( "Server is busy please try later!" ); } } } function dateComp_ajax(action) { var id = document.addlistingform_step2.txt_avail_date.value ; var url="../include/details.php?id="+id+"&act="+action ; //for non-IE browsers if(window.XMLHttpRequest) { req=new XMLHttpRequest(); } else //IF IE browsers if(window.ActiveXObject) { req=new ActiveXObject("Microsoft.XMLHTTP"); } req.open("POST",url,true); req.onreadystatechange=parseResults_datcomp ; req.send(null); } function parseResults_datcomp() { //var combo1 = new Array() ; var selectedarray = new Array() ; var combo1 = new Array() ; if(req.readyState==4) { if(req.status==200) { SResponse=req.responseText; var details = SResponse.split("####") ; alert(details[0]); //alert(details[1]); if(details[0]=="tdate") { if(details[1] == '0'){ alert('Please specify valid availablity date.'); document.addlistingform_step2.txt_avail_date.focus(); } } } else { alert ( "Server is busy please try later!" ); } } } function make_popup(url) { window.open(url,'','width=900 , height=500') ; }